Description

Lemus, a Danish manufacturer specializing in furniture with integrated audio, has decided to move a significant part of its production from China to Denmark. Specifically, in 2021, it reshored to Denmark the production of cabinets for their loudspeakers. Through this operation, the company aims to improve its resilience in the face of global economic uncertainties, reduces freight costs and lead times and enhances product quality and control over the value chain. Also, this move will allow to support job creation in Denmark, reduce CO2 emissions, and use European certified wood. The company recognizes that production in Denmark is more costly, but when including factors like complaints, shipping and lead times, the price difference equalizes.
